Transaction 2cab63798399ce91a82e453f581a43945201d23fc9d64c88ab7370d750db0f68
1 Input
1 Output
-
2cab63798399ce91a82e453f581a43945201d23fc9d64c88ab7370d750db0f68:0
- value
- 8983189
- script pubkey
- OP_0 OP_PUSHBYTES_20 4f00fb30cda9eb59014d654183600f0586653db0
- address
- bc1qfuq0kvxd4844jq2dv4qcxcq0qkrx20dsneme02